Policies bought a clause at a time
TermsFeed builds a privacy policy, terms, a disclaimer or a cookie notice from a questionnaire, and prices each clause separately, so a page that only runs analytics and an affiliate link pays for those two and nothing else. Nothing renews. That makes it the cheapest honest option for a one-off site, and a poor fit for anybody who wants the document maintained for them.
Our note
Add up the provisions you need before comparing this to a subscription, because four or five of them costs more than a year of iubenda. Its advantage is that a document you buy once does not stop working when you stop paying.

A site builder that edits like a document
Typedream builds a website the way a document is written, with slash commands and blocks rather than a canvas and a grid, which suits somebody who wants a site finished this afternoon. A free tier publishes on a subdomain. Paid plans add a custom domain, a free first-year .xyz registration and the CMS. The document metaphor is also the ceiling: a layout that needs precise control over where things sit is not what this is for.

Our note
Try the free tier against your actual homepage copy before paying, because whether this suits you is entirely a question of whether your site is document-shaped. If it is, you will be finished faster here than anywhere else on this list.
